Choose the Right High-End Gun for the Task

Selecting the right firearm is a crucial step in preparing for your fall hunting trip. Opting for a high-quality gun not only enhances your experience but improves your efficiency as well. Some popular choices for hunting in the fall include:

  • Bolt-action rifles: for deer, elk, and other big game
  • Over/under shotguns:for upland birds and waterfowl
  • Semi-automatic shotguns: for versatility and quick follow-up shots

Remember that investing in a quality gun ensures reliability, accuracy, and durability, which is imperative for a successful hunting trip.

Dress for Success and Comfort

Equally as important as your firearm is your choice of clothing and hunting gear. Look for gear designed specifically for hunting, including:

  • Insulated and waterproof clothing
  • Quiet fabrics that minimize noise
  • Camouflage that suits the environment
  • High-visibility gear, if needed

Investing in high-quality hunting apparel ensures you remain comfortable, warm, and dry, ultimately enhancing your focus and performance.

Fine-Tune Your Hunting Skills

Even the best guns and gear won’t guarantee success if you don’t hone your hunting skills. Practicing marksmanship at the range, learning effective stalking techniques, and understanding animal behavior improve your chances of a rewarding outing.

Pro Tip: Before you go out, head to your local gun range to get some practice in, especially if it’s been a while since your last hunting venture.

Scout Your Hunting Area

Familiarize yourself with the area where you plan to hunt. Scouting it beforehand will also ensure you follow the four Cs of responsible hunting, so make sure you take that time before beginning your actual hunting trip. Look for signs of animal activity, including tracks, food sources, and bedding areas. This knowledge will help you identify the best spots and increase your likelihood of success.
